Transaction 2e4aac046f434a6d58843d46a643dc32a332d08fb0deceebdff7a8d680b185f3

176 Input
2 Outputs
  • 2e4aac046f434a6d58843d46a643dc32a332d08fb0deceebdff7a8d680b185f3:0
  • value  143256360
    address  34mD3JeSLtg86nustmjcZnx5axG8BLvwFp
  • 2e4aac046f434a6d58843d46a643dc32a332d08fb0deceebdff7a8d680b185f3:1
  • value  4000000000
    address  3CDz5vtJy8LbVJ56Eav9J14z8Dit8qttPF